Description:
Computes the conductor and reduction types for a genus 2 hyperelliptic
curve.
As an example of genus2reduction's functionality, let C be a proper
smooth curve of genus 2 defined by a hyperelliptic equation
y^2+Q(x)y=P(x), where P(x) and Q(x) are polynomials with rational
coefficients such that deg(Q(x))<4, deg(P(x))<7. Let J(C) be the
Jacobian of C, let X be the minimal regular model of C over the ring of
integers Z.
This program determines the reduction of C at any prime number p (that
is the special fiber X_p of X over p), and the exponent f of the
conductor of J(C) at p.
